Transaction f312d90dae55e762c52ad0113cd04ed7d52c488838b5d7dcc0577d30251207cc
1 Input
1 Output
-
f312d90dae55e762c52ad0113cd04ed7d52c488838b5d7dcc0577d30251207cc:0
- value
- 20685187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 873ab6add9b5ac6d3b921104b5d841dcba97cacc OP_EQUAL
- address
- 3E23Uw3cnmpGnEMWnMo9zwqdDzH6zPR4md